On February 2, the 60MW fishery-photovoltaic complementary solar power generation project of Ganneng Co., Ltd. in the Ganjiang New Area was successfully connected to the grid. Located at the Jiangxia Branch of the Sanghai Group in Xinqizhou, Ganjiang New Area, Nanchang, Jiangxi Province, the project has a total investment of 1.8 billion yuan. It adopts the model of "power generation on water and aquaculture underwater," with an average annual power generation of approximately 66 million kilowatt-hours. Over its entire lifecycle, the project is expected to contribute around 65 million yuan in taxes.
